Finding Peace Through Prayer: A Journey with Jesus

Peace in this world can often feel elusive. Our minds hurry with anxieties and worries, leaving little room for tranquility. But what if I told you there's a path to discover lasting peace? A journey that begins with opening your heart to Jesus through prayer.

Prayer isn't just about seeking things from God; it's about cultivating a relationship with Him. When we converse with Jesus, we find solace in His guidance. He soothes our fears and fills us in His comfort. This journey isn't always easy; there will be times when doubt creeps in and struggles arise. But through it all, Jesus is with us, offering His unwavering support. He walks beside us, guiding our steps and encouraging us to persist on the path to peace.

Jesus' Teachings on Prayer: Pathways to Intimacy

Prayer isn't simply a appeal uttered into the void. Rather, Jesus unveils prayer as a profound path toward deepening our relationship with the Divine. He underscores the significance of approaching God with reverence, not as distant supplicants but as cherished children.

Jesus urges us to strive for a genuine connection through honest communication. In his teachings, we find guidance on how to articulate our needs, offering not just a list of demands but a outpouring of our hearts.

Jesus' illustration in prayer shows us the beauty of a heart-to-heart encounter with God. He invites us to discover that true prayer is a journey, not just a destination, a continuous conversation that enriches our souls and brings us closer to the Divine.
